How many kVA is 1000 watts? The kVA rating for 1000 watts depends on the power factor. ![]() Why is the rating of a transformer in kVA or VA? The rating of a transformer is in kVA or VA because it indicates the apparent power handling capacity of the transformer, considering both real power (Watts) and reactive power (VARs). Why do transformers use VA instead of Watts? Transformers use VA (Volt-Amperes) because they account for both active power (Watts) and reactive power (VARs), providing a more comprehensive measure of power flow in AC circuits. How do you convert VA to power? To convert VA to power (Watts), multiply VA by the power factor (W = VA × Power Factor). They both consider the voltage and current in an AC circuit.
